What is the difference between legal aid lawyers and pro bono lawyers?

Jul 19, 2013 · There are no specific "pro bono lawyers in Coeur d'Alene." Idaho attorneys provide pro bono client representation through the Idaho Volunteer Lawyers Program. Regrettably the demand and expectation for free legal representation in contested child custody matters far exceeds the ability of the caring and diligent members of the Idaho State Bar to provide.

Does Idaho have legal aid?

Idaho Legal Aid Services, Inc. assists low-income and senior (age 60 and older) Idahoans with civil legal issues.Feb 7, 2022

Should pro bono be italicized?

italicizing legal terms of art – Many of these terms, such as “pro bono,” “guardian ad litem,” and “pro se” should not be italicized; they are generally accepted in everyday use. Here's a rule of thumb: If the term appears in the Merriam Webster Collegiate Dictionary, do not italicize it. (There will be exceptions.

IVLP Makes Volunteering as Easy as Possible

  1. IVLP staff screens applicants to make sure they are low-income and have appropriate types of cases.
  2. IVLP staff will match you with eligible applicants.
  3. The IVLP can connect you with a mentor to help when it's a new area of law for you.
  4. The IVLP provides malpractice insurance (if needed).
